Hello all,
I 've got a problem with Ovi maps and the built-in GPS sensor. i've used this before and was quite pleased with the accuracy of the GPS sensor which positioned me spot-on in front of the right house of a street while walking and followed my routes by car, train or bus correctly.

But now, even with an established network connection (UMTS or wi-fi), the GPS is always listed as with "low accuracy" ("Grobe Genauigkeit", my German-language UI says), and the accuracy has indeed gone way downhill. Even while walking, the sensor is off by one to ten blocks (50 to 500 metres), plus it my position is updated very infrequently, only every 200 to 500 metres as opposed to continuously like it did before).

To my knowledge, I haven't changed any relevant settings, though I'm not entirely sure whether the last update (PR1.1.1) came before or after the problems started. As it is now, the GPS sensor is pretty much unusable.

Does anybody have any idea what might have happened? Can anyone give me any pointers as to how to find out or get closer to the source of the problem? Any help ist very much appreciated.
